Secret Life of Stuff

Discover the intricacies of our material world with "Secret Life of Stuff" by Julie Hill MBE, published in 2011 by Vintage Publishing. This eye-opening book delves into the Economics of Consumption and the environmental impacts of our everyday choices. With a compelling narrative spanning 368 pages, Hill invites politicians, business leaders, and consumers alike to reflect on past mistakes and collaborate towards a sustainable future. By unveiling the hidden stories behind the products we use, she inspires a collective movement to reimagine our relationship with natural resources and manufacturers.
